Strong's #2067: esthesis (pronounced es'-thay-sis)

from a derivative of 2066; clothing (concretely):--government.




Thayer's Greek Lexicon:

̓́

esthēsis

1) clothing, apparel

Part of Speech: noun feminine

Relation: from a derivative of G2066




Usage:

This word is used 1 times:

Luke 24:4: "stood by them in shining garments:"
